What is XRP?
XRP is a cryptocurrency that is primarily used for cross-border payments and as a bridge currency for financial institutions. It was created by the company Ripple in 2012 and is currently the seventh larg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ization. XRP is often referred to as the "banker's coin" due to its focus on working with traditional financial institutions.
Why is XRP surging?
XRP has experienced a significant surge in value, rising past $3 for the first time since 2018. This surge is largely attributed to optimism surrounding the ongoing legal battle between Ripple and the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The SEC filed a lawsuit against Ripple in December 2020, claiming that XRP is an unregistered security. However, recent developments in the case have sparked hope among investors that Ripple may have a strong defense and could potentially win the case.
What is the SEC's appeal strategy?
The SEC recently filed an appeal against a ruling that allowed Ripple to access internal SEC documents related to the classification of cryptocurrencies as securities. This move by the SEC has been seen as a tactic to delay the case and potentially reach a settlement with Ripple. Many investors see this as a positive sign for Ripple and XRP, as it could indicate that the SEC may be open to a compromise.

What are ETFs and why are they important? ETFs, or Exchange Traded Funds, are investment vehicles that track the performance of a specific asset or group of assets, such as stocks, commodities, or in this case, cryptocurrencies. These funds allow investors to gain exposure to the crypto market without directly owning the underlying assets, making it an attractive option for those looking to diversify their portfolio and manage risk.
